Company Description

NielsenIQ is a global measurement and data analytics company that provides the most complete and trusted view available of consumers and markets worldwide. We provide consumer packaged goods manufacturers/fast-moving consumer goods and retailers with accurate, actionable information and insights and a complete picture of the complex and changing marketplace that companies need to innovate and grow. Our approach marries proprietary NielsenIQ data with other data sources to help clients around the world understand what’s happening now, what’s happening next, and how to best act on this knowledge.  We like to be in the middle of the action. That’s why you can find us at work in over 90 countries, covering more than 90% of the world’s population. Job Description

About the job 

Act as the main point of contact from Reference Data Operations to internal client services to lead and drive the operational design and delivery of our client offering. Responsible for overall Reference Data Operations department quality performance monitoring, reporting and analysis by driving an on-going focus and improvement in Right First Time delivery to contribute to client satisfaction. Team management - Leads a team of Data Operations Analysts. 

Responsibilities 

Client Solutioning 

  • Acts as front-facing point of contact for client database operational queries and in ensuring overall quality performance monitoring, reporting and analysis in Right First Time delivery. 

  • Consistently work with other Operations Functions' leads within the country to manage projects and deliver on clients’ commitments. 

  • Participation in quality improvement plans such as Quality Walk, Quality Focus Meetings, Root Cause Analysis activities and Operational Excellence programs. 

  • Work closely with Client Liaison management team to support the creation, monitoring and execution of quality plans for strategic and hot spot clients. 

  • Proactively communicates with client / client services for any potential delays / risks based on information by Ops teams. 

  • Manage close links with Enablement team/leads to identify focus areas and ensuring quality / delivery standards are achieved. 

  • Ability to provide workload and timeline estimation by taking into consideration requirements of each upstream activities. 

  • Represent respective operation’s function in discussion with other NOC and in market stakeholders. 

Team Management 

  • Plans and controls resource allocation to optimize the “operations service” to clients as well as highlights any resources issue 

  • Expected to coach and develop the team, monitor individual performances by identifying talents or low performers and promote engagement within the team 

  • Acts as an escalation point for the team and constantly reviews and assesses team's KPIs periodically 

Qualifications

  • Minimum experience of 7+ years in operations Team Handling

  • Proven leadership skills – to manage teams, to manage projects, able to identify the talent, inspire and engage the team 

  • Strong communication skills and the ability to communicate requirements clearly to stakeholders within and outside of Operations 

  • Proven organizational skills and the ability to work within a cross-functional team 

  • Project management skills - ability to accurately scope project requirements and manage stakeholder expectations

About NIQ

NIQ is the world’s leading consumer intelligence company, delivering the most complete understanding of consumer buying behavior and revealing new pathways to growth. In 2023, NIQ combined with GfK, bringing together the two industry leaders with unparalleled global reach. With a holistic retail read and the most comprehensive consumer insights—delivered with advanced analytics through state-of-the-art platforms—NIQ delivers the Full View™. NIQ is an Advent International portfolio company with operations in 100+ markets, covering more than 90% of the world’s population.
